CLK (Pin 6): Clock. This clock synchronizes the serial data
transfer. A minimum CLK pulse of 60ns signals the ADC to
wake up from Nap or Sleep mode.
CONV (Pin 7): Conversion Start Signal. This active high
signal starts a conversion on its rising edge. Keeping CLK
low and pulsing CONV two/four times will put the ADC into
Nap/Sleep mode.
SHDN (Pin 8): Shutdown Input. Pull this pin Low to put the
ADC in Shutdown mode and save power (REFRDY will go
Low). The device will draw 4.5µA in this mode.
